The Moon Palace Golf & Spa Resort in Cancun, Mexico, has been chosen as the host venue for the “MeetDifferent” conference by Meeting professionals International (MPI), to be held on February 20, 2010. The Moon Palace’s meeting facilities include 142,000 square feet of flexible meeting space with permanent staging, the capacity for up to 8,600 attendees, and the option of 40 breakouts.
“It is a great honor to be recognized by such a distinguished organization as Meeting Professionals International,” said Ginny Davito, Vice President, Group & Incentive Sales for Palace Resorts. “With their attention to member development and extensive worldwide membership base, we look forward to welcoming MPI to the Moon Palace Golf & Spa Resort in 2010.”
MPI’s “MeetDifferent” conference is typically the organization’s first event of a new year and features a range of speakers, seminars and networking events. A global meeting planner organization, MPI has an estimated membership of 23,000 members belonging to 68 chapters and clubs worldwide.
